After a rebuild of our SCCM server the applications and packages default to 'Manually copy the content in this package to the distribution point'. Previously the default was set to 'Automatically download the content when packages are assigned to distribution points'.

 

Thus far I've been able to manually change this setting before distributing content but after the recent upgrade to SCCM 1606 the "Configuration Manager Client" has the options greyed out meaning that I'm now a little stuck. This means that the Content Status is now stuck as in progress.

 

So can anyone tell me how to change the defaults and how to fix my issue with the config mgr client package?

Why are you trying to manually copy it? ;s What's your setup in terms of servers etc?

 

All you should need to do is hit the Distribute content button and it'll send it out to all the servers. (If you deployed it already it'll auto start but can just click distribute to confirm :p )

 

All prestaging is for is to send out the packages to slow-link sites (think over WAN etc) so they have the packages before you need to do any deployments, If you don't have separate servers offsite ignore prestaged and use normal distribution
